WebTypically these batteries derive energy from the reaction between zinc metal and manganese dioxide, nickel and cadmium, or nickel and hydrogen . Compared with zinc–carbon batteries of the Leclanché cell or zinc … Batteries are classified into primary and secondary forms: • Primary batteries are designed to be used until exhausted of energy then discarded. Their chemical reactions are generally not reversible, so they cannot be recharged. When the supply of reactants in the battery is exhausted, the battery stops producing current and is useless. • Secondary batteries can be recharged; that is, they can have their chemical reactions reversed b…
